Transaction e6f54ccc657ecfaeeac2ceacd61cb79e4c958db46ffcb0f835d427a120828507
1 Input
1 Output
-
e6f54ccc657ecfaeeac2ceacd61cb79e4c958db46ffcb0f835d427a120828507:0
- value
- 74065
- script pubkey
- OP_0 OP_PUSHBYTES_20 0457b12e424a67b94b443d1379a2996f84afd4f2
- address
- bc1qq3tmztjzffnmjj6y85fhng5ed7z2l48j57l6zy